Abstract: The aim of this study was to conduct a survey to monitor the population of Thrips tabaci in district of Aligarh, located in Uttar Pradesh region, during the favorable growing season of tomato crops. The main objective was to provide relevant information on the infestation levels and abundance of Thrips tabaci population. Thrips tabaci, commonly known as “Onion Thrips”, is primarily known to infest onion crops (Allium cepa).The survey focused on three villages in this region, namely Jalali, Pikhaloni and Harduaganj. We collected data on the infestation and abundance of Thrips tabaci in these localities. Our findings indicated that infestation and damage caused by Thrips tabaci on tomato fields bagan in the last week of September, with the highest population levels recorded in the first week of November.
